A beautifully refurbished, end terrace house which has had a fantastic vaulted kitchen extension, together with a loft conversion.

Location - The fashionable suburb of South Knighton is located approximately two miles south of the city centre, providing excellent access to the professional quarters and mainline railway station. The Queens Road shopping parade in neighbouring Clarendon Park is within easy walking distance and offers a good range of boutiques, post office, bars and restaurants. Excellent state and private schooling is also within easy reach, and an abundance of recreational facilities including tennis, golf and swimming.

Accommodation - The property is entered via a uPVC double glazed front door leading into the front reception room, with a uPVC double glazed bay window to the front, built-in meter cupboard, inset ceiling spotlights, a tiled inglenook space for a log burner, wood effect flooring and is open to a second reception room, having inset ceiling spotlights, a tiled inglenook space for a log burner, wood effect flooring, a uPVC double glazed window to the rear elevation and a door leading to an inner lobby housing the stairs to the first floor and providing external access to the side of the house. The kitchen has a window to the side elevation and a good range of eye and base level units and drawers, ample preparation surfaces, a circular stainless steel sink and drainer unit with mixer tap over, tiled splashbacks, an integrated Indesit oven with Zanussi four-ring gas hob and stainless steel extractor unit above, integrated fridge and freezer, space and plumbing for an automatic washing machine, inset ceiling spotlights, tiled flooring and is open to a light, airy garden room area with tiled flooring, a uPVC double window to the front, a uPVC double glazed Velux rooflight and double glazed French doors leading onto the garden.

To the first floor a landing houses the stairs to the loft conversion. The master bedroom has a uPVC double glazed window to the rear elevation, an inglenook space for a log burner, and an overstairs storage cupboard. Bedroom two has a feature cast iron fireplace and a uPVC double glazed window to the rear. The bathroom has a four-piece suite comprising a tiled corner shower cubicle, a feature bath on claw feet, a low flush WC, pedestal wash hand basin, electric shaver point, chrome heated towel rail and an opaque uPVC double glazed window to the rear. On the second floor, a loft conversion with feature glass and wooden balustrades, provides a further double bedroom with a uPVC double glazed Velux skylight to the front elevation and a dormer extension with a uPVC double glazed window to the rear elevation.

Outside - To the front of the property is a small front forecourt behind wrought a low level brick wall. Gated side access leads to attractive, low maintenance gardens with a lawned area, paved patio, fenced and walled boundaries.

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
